Thermal Fluid High Temp Systems

TCU's with electric heaters and chilled water exchangers or air coolers provide tight temperature control for applications including:
   •
Resin and plastic platens
   • Extruders Hot melt exchangers
   •Temperatured sheet rolls
   •High speed printers
   •
Cooked food processing
These systems can be designed to reach temperatures to +750°F.

Syltherm Systems

TCU's are often used in pharmaceutical applications for cyclical conditions ranging from -20°F to +400°F. Heat transfer and flow are calculated to generate optimal thermal and hydraulic performance. These units can include: expansion tank, integral deaerator, and thermal buffer section to reduce start-up time by eliminating steam, gases, and volatiles from the thermal oil. These systems are commonly used for reactor and condenser applications.

Validation

TCS Engineered Products can provide calibration and documentation to support Validation, Factory Acceptance Testing (FAT), as well as detailed support documentation for manufacture and start-up.

In addition to detailed P&ID and AutoCAD drawings, factory calibration of certain instruments and data sheet approvals by inspectors are also available. TCS includes signed pressure testing reports on all vessels and piping. ASME and National Board Certificates are provided as standard documentation for all pressure vessels and heat exchangers.

Propylene Glycol Systems

Compact TCU's for glycol systems are available in standard sizes from 30 to 300 GPM as well as custom applications. Units can be used to heat and cool conventional half pipe glassed, and alloy reactors, as well as tumble, rotary, and tray dryers. Higher flow rates are available upon request.
